Free radical polymerization of stryene gives a product in which groups are on alternate carbon atoms rather than on adjacent carbon atoms. Exlpain.

Answer»

SOLUTION :During free radical polymerization , the ADDITION of free radicals to monomer molecules occurs in accrodance with Markovnikov's rule so as to give more stable free radical. For example , addition of R. (obtained from radical initiator) to styrene GIVES more stable BENZYLIC radical (I) rather than less stable radical (II).

The free radical (I) then adds to another monomer molecule again giving a more stable free radical (III) rather than the less stable free radical (IV). This process continues to give ultimately polystyrene (V) in whicyh the `C_6H_5` groups are on alternate carbon atoms rather than the product (VI) in which the `C_6H_5` groups are on adjacent carbon atoms.
